Output 24180a3c8a052abf6fc5347615c44e100031737ba115274002cc00840377bbf0:12

value
38367447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c44c3f5202b65178562954a284ae03a15a692e OP_EQUAL
address
3KSrAmjA7QP5dTAkyog2beSfhYmn18jkmb
transaction
24180a3c8a052abf6fc5347615c44e100031737ba115274002cc00840377bbf0
spent
true